Catalogue Essay
A. Lange & Söhne, renowned for its precision and artistry, has long been a symbol of excellence in haute horlogerie. Among its most iconic creations, the Lange 1 stands as a defining model, first introduced in 1994 as part of the brand’s rebirth. With its asymmetrical dial layout, outsize date, and impeccable craftsmanship, the Lange 1 quickly became a cornerstone of the brand’s identity and a modern classic in watchmaking.
Created to celebrate the 20th anniversary of the iconic Lange 1, A. Lange & Söhne released five exclusive "His & Hers" sets, each limited to 20 pairs. Each set includes a 38.5mm Lange 1 and a 36.1mm Little Lange 1, available in platinum, white gold, or pink gold, like the present example. The dials are crafted from solid silver and adorned with guilloché engraving.
Cased in pink gold, the present example features a hand-crafted silver guilloché dial giving it a sophisticated and elegant look. This timepiece is furthermore preserved in excellent condition with crisp hallmarks and deep engravings, along with its leather wallet, travel pouch, Guarantee & service booklet.
The matching Little Lange 1 is available in the following lot for an esteemed collector who wishes to re-unite the set.

A. Lange & Söhne
German | 1845Originally founded in 1845 by Ferdinand Adolph Lange in Glashütte, Dresden, Germany, the firm established an entire watchmaking culture and industry in Glashütte. The brand quickly became Germany's finest watchmaker, first creating dependable, easy-to-repair watches before going on to produce some of the world's finest complicated pocket watches, including Grande Sonnerie watches, tourbillon watches and Grande Complications.
On the final day of World War II, their factories were destroyed by Russian bombers, and in 1948 the brand was confiscated by the Soviet Union. Following the fall of the Berlin Wall in 1990, Ferdinand's great grandson Walter Lange re-established the brand with the objective to once again produce top-quality luxury watches. Now part of the Richemont Group, its original vintage and modern creations are highly coveted by collectors. Key models from the modern era include the Lange 1, Pour Le Mérite Tourbillon and the Zeitwerk.
